Xan wrote: ↑Fri Jul 22, 2022 8:57 pm
Isn't that exactly what was intended when they designed it?
Yes they did...back in the day they specifically made sure Boston, NY and Philly would not run the country due to out populating everyone else...and that's why we have a house which is based on population and a senate which is not.

yankees60 wrote: ↑Fri Jul 22, 2022 9:19 pmYou do live in Texas. Why should you only get 2/7 the representation of someone in Wyoming?
I'm pretty dubious about the exact numbers, but the reason is that the small states needed to buy in too, and they wouldn't have without this compromise. Without this compromise, we wouldn't have this whole country in the first place.
